May is one of the warmer months of the year in Madurai, with average highs near 40.2°C and lows around 23.5°C (mean 31.9°C). It is about average for rainfall, averaging 92 mm of rainfall and 63% relative humidity across the period.
May is one of the warmer months of the year in Madurai. Across 45 years of records, the warmest May in Madurai was 1991 — when the month averaged 33.7°C — while the coldest was 2004 at 29.9°C. Typical May days reach 40.2°C with nights near 23.5°C. The long-term May temperature trend is broadly flat.

| Metric | 1980s | 1990s | 2000s | 2010s | 2020s | Change |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Avg Temp | 31.9°C | 32.1°C | 31.8°C | 31.8°C | 31.6°C | -0.3°C |
| Avg High | 40.4°C | 40.7°C | 40.3°C | 39.8°C | 39.6°C | -0.8°C |
| Avg Low | 23.5°C | 23.4°C | 23.3°C | 23.7°C | 23.5°C | 0°C |
| Avg Rain | 72 mm | 80 mm | 110 mm | 95 mm | 104 mm | +32 mm |
May temperatures in Madurai have fallen by about 0.4°C between 1981–1985 and 2021–2025.
May has ranged from a record low of 22.1°C (2022) to a record high of 42.7°C (1991).
Rainfall in May is about average for rainfall, averaging 92 mm, with a wettest year of 298 mm.
Daytime highs and overnight lows have shifted differently — highs fell about 0.2°C per decade while lows rose 0.1°C per decade, narrowing the gap between day and night.

| Year | High | Low | Avg | Rainfall | Humidity | Wind | Solar |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2025 | 38.3°C | 24.3°C | 31.3°C | 114 mm | 68% | 2.1 m/s | 5.6 |
| 2024 | 42.5°C | 24.2°C | 33.4°C | 162 mm | 68% | 1.9 m/s | 5.2 |
| 2023 | 38.1°C | 23.3°C | 30.7°C | 98 mm | 72% | 1.5 m/s | 5.8 |
| 2022 | 38.6°C | 22.1°C | 30.4°C | 97 mm | 67% | 2 m/s | 5.8 |
| 2021 | 38.6°C | 22.8°C | 30.7°C | 90 mm | 71% | 2.2 m/s | 5.8 |
| 2020 | 41.2°C | 24.5°C | 32.9°C | 61 mm | 61% | 2.1 m/s | 5.7 |
| 2019 | 41.6°C | 24.9°C | 33.2°C | 25 mm | 50% | 1.8 m/s | 6.1 |
| 2018 | 37.7°C | 23.5°C | 30.6°C | 134 mm | 71% | 1.8 m/s | 5.5 |
| 2017 | 40.2°C | 23.6°C | 31.9°C | 106 mm | 63% | 1.9 m/s | 5.7 |
| 2016 | 42.3°C | 23.5°C | 32.9°C | 101 mm | 62% | 2.2 m/s | 5.8 |
| 2015 | 37.7°C | 23.2°C | 30.5°C | 178 mm | 73% | 1.8 m/s | 5.6 |
| 2014 | 38.2°C | 23.5°C | 30.9°C | 162 mm | 70% | 1.8 m/s | 5.7 |
| 2013 | 41.2°C | 24.4°C | 32.8°C | 36 mm | 53% | 2.3 m/s | 5.9 |
| 2012 | 39.5°C | 23.3°C | 31.4°C | 66 mm | 66% | 1.7 m/s | 6.1 |
| 2011 | 40.3°C | 22.4°C | 31.3°C | 67 mm | 59% | 1.8 m/s | 6.6 |
| 2010 | 39.4°C | 24.8°C | 32.1°C | 74 mm | 64% | 2 m/s | 6.1 |
| 2009 | 42.5°C | 23.8°C | 33.1°C | 36 mm | 55% | 1.9 m/s | 6.1 |
| 2008 | 39.9°C | 22.8°C | 31.3°C | 56 mm | 62% | 1.8 m/s | 6.5 |
| 2007 | 41.3°C | 23.8°C | 32.5°C | 49 mm | 58% | 1.9 m/s | 6.4 |
| 2006 | 41.6°C | 23.4°C | 32.5°C | 138 mm | 63% | 2.2 m/s | 6.1 |
| 2005 | 39.4°C | 23.5°C | 31.5°C | 77 mm | 68% | 1.6 m/s | 6.2 |
| 2004 ❄️ 🌧️ | 37.3°C | 22.6°C | 29.9°C | 298 mm | 78% | 2 m/s | 5.4 |
| 2003 | 40.8°C | 23.9°C | 32.4°C | 129 mm | 65% | 2 m/s | 5.8 |
| 2002 | 40.7°C | 23.7°C | 32.2°C | 134 mm | 68% | 2.2 m/s | 6.1 |
| 2001 | 38.3°C | 22.4°C | 30.3°C | 87 mm | 67% | 2 m/s | 6.5 |
| 2000 | 41.3°C | 22.9°C | 32.1°C | 94 mm | 55% | 1.9 m/s | 6.3 |
| 1999 | 40.0°C | 22.6°C | 31.3°C | 152 mm | 72% | 2 m/s | 6 |
| 1998 | 40.9°C | 24.1°C | 32.5°C | 87 mm | 61% | 2.1 m/s | 5.5 |
| 1997 | 41.0°C | 22.9°C | 32.0°C | 68 mm | 60% | 1.9 m/s | 5.6 |
| 1996 | 40.7°C | 23.8°C | 32.2°C | 15 mm | 59% | 1.6 m/s | 6.1 |
| 1995 | 38.5°C | 22.3°C | 30.4°C | 90 mm | 66% | 2.1 m/s | 5.6 |
| 1994 | 39.3°C | 22.8°C | 31.0°C | 139 mm | 66% | 1.8 m/s | 6.1 |
| 1993 | 42.1°C | 23.9°C | 33.0°C | 55 mm | 57% | 2.1 m/s | 6 |
| 1992 | 41.5°C | 23.3°C | 32.4°C | 63 mm | 58% | 2 m/s | 5.9 |
| 1991 🔥 | 42.7°C | 24.6°C | 33.7°C | 11 mm | 50% | 2.1 m/s | 5.9 |
| 1990 | 40.7°C | 23.6°C | 32.2°C | 121 mm | 64% | 2.4 m/s | 5.4 |
| 1989 | 42.2°C | 23.2°C | 32.7°C | 49 mm | 55% | 2.3 m/s | 5.8 |
| 1988 | 39.8°C | 23.7°C | 31.8°C | 51 mm | 61% | 2 m/s | 5.7 |
| 1987 | 39.8°C | 23.9°C | 31.8°C | 50 mm | 58% | 1.9 m/s | 5.9 |
| 1986 | 41.4°C | 23.7°C | 32.5°C | 45 mm | 55% | 2.2 m/s | 6.2 |
| 1985 | 41.6°C | 23.7°C | 32.6°C | 59 mm | 56% | 2.3 m/s | 5.9 |
| 1984 | 39.6°C | 23.4°C | 31.5°C | 34 mm | 62% | 2.1 m/s | 6.2 |
| 1983 | 42.3°C | 24.1°C | 33.2°C | 74 mm | 56% | 1.8 m/s | — |
| 1982 | 38.1°C | 22.5°C | 30.3°C | 145 mm | 68% | 1.8 m/s | — |
| 1981 | 38.6°C | 23.1°C | 30.9°C | 143 mm | 68% | 1.8 m/s | — |
Actual recorded May data for each year, 1981–2025 — sourced from NASA POWER.
